243. Deputy Thomas Gould asked the Minister for Transport his views on the use of amber traffic lights to indicate ‘go’ on cycle lanes. [7244/25]

View answer

Written answers

As Minister for Transport, I have responsibility for policy and overall funding in relation to Active Travel. Funding is administered through the National Transport Authority (NTA), who, in partnership with local authorities, have responsibility for the selection and development of specific projects in each local authority area. The NTA has also developed the Cycle Design Manual to provide guidance to Local Authorities in the development of cycling infrastructure.

Noting the role of the NTA in the matter, I have referred your question to that agency for a more detailed answer. If you do not receive a reply within 10 working days, please contact my private office.

A referred reply was forwarded to the Deputy under Standing Orders.
